Proper Preparation is Key
Before you even think about installing a resin driveway, you need to make sure that the site is properly prepared. This involves removing any debris or vegetation, and ensuring that the area is level and compacted.
Choose the Right Type of Resin
There are several types of resins available, and it is important to choose the right one for your specific project. Factors such as UV stability, curing time, and color options should all be considered.
Consider the Climate
The climate in your area can have a significant impact on the performance of your resin driveway. If you live in an area with extreme temperatures, you may need to choose a resin that is more resistant to temperature changes.
Proper Mixing is Essential
To ensure that your resin driveway is strong and durable, it is essential that the resin and hardener are mixed properly. This will ensure that the resin cures properly and bonds with the stones.
Get the Right Tools
Installing a requires specialized tools such as a trowel, mixing paddle, and a roller. It is important to have these tools on hand before you begin the installation process.
Keep the Surface Clean
To keep your resin driveway looking its best, it is important to keep it clean. Regular sweeping and washing will help to prevent the buildup of dirt and debris.
Address Any Cracks Immediately
If you notice any cracks in your resin driveway, it is important to address them immediately. This will help to prevent them from spreading and causing further damage.
Consider Adding a Border
Adding a border to your resin driveway can help to define the space and give it a more finished look. This can be done using stones of a different color or size.
Choose the Right Stone Size
The size of the stones used in your can have a big impact on its appearance and durability. Larger stones may be more visually appealing, but smaller stones will create a more durable surface.
Consider Adding Texture
Adding texture to yourย can make it more slip-resistant and give it a more natural look. This can be done by adding a non-slip additive to the resin or using stones with a rougher texture.
Allow Proper Curing Time
After your resin driveway is installed, it is important to allow it to cure properly. This can take several days, depending on the type of resin used and the temperature and humidity levels in your area.
Maintain Proper Drainage
To prevent water from pooling on your resin driveway, it is important to maintain proper drainage. This can be done by ensuring that the surface is sloped correctly and installing drainage channels if necessary.

Address Any Stains Promptly
If you notice any stains on your resin driveway, it is important to address them promptly. This will help to prevent them from setting and becoming more difficult to remove.
Consider Hiring a Professional
While it is possible to install a resin driveway yourself, it can be a complex and time-consuming process. Consider hiring a professional to ensure that the job is done correctly.
Regular Maintenance is Essential
To keep your resin driveway looking its best and performing well, it is important to perform regular maintenance. This includes cleaning, addressing any cracks or stains, and ensuring that proper drainage is maintained.
